How we work

HOW WE CAN HELP YOU

Wellbeing is NOT linear. We meet you where you are and walk alongside you at a pace that feels safe and sustainable.

Change that fits into real life

Sustainable progress, not pressure.

We support you to integrate new skills and insights into your daily routines, relationships, and environments — helping wellbeing feel achievable rather than overwhelming. This phase focuses on confidence, flexibility, and maintaining progress over time.


We begin by creating space

Slow down. Feel heard.

A space to slow down, feel heard, and reflect without pressure to perform or "fix" everything at once. Many people come to us after long periods of coping, pushing through, or managing on their own. This first step is about stabilising, building trust, and understanding what has been weighing on you.


We listen and learn about your experience in context

Your whole life- not just your symptoms.

This includes your emotional world, daily routines, relationships, physical health, identity, and environment. Through occupational therapy and therapy-informed support, we explore patterns, strengths, and what you're navigating, so your experience makes sense within the wider picture of your life.


We build practical and emotional skills together

Tailored, evidence-informed, and goal-centered.

This may include developing emotional regulation strategies, strengthening routines, improving functioning, increasing insight, or working through patterns shaped by stress, trauma, or neurodivergence. Support is evidence-informed, trauma-aware, and tailored to your goals.


Wellbeing is ongoing, not an endpoint

We're here when you need us, now and later.

Some people engage with us for a specific period; others return at different points in life when additional support is helpful. We aim to equip you with tools, understanding, and self-trust so you feel better able to navigate future chapters.
